About Purnachandra Saha

Purnachandra Saha is a scholar working on Civil and Structural Engineering, Building and Construction and Pollution, having authored 37 papers that have together received 812 indexed citations. Recurring topics across this work include Concrete and Cement Materials Research (13 papers), Seismic Performance and Analysis (9 papers) and Innovative concrete reinforcement materials (9 papers). The work is most often cited by research in Civil and Structural Engineering (710 citations), Building and Construction (151 citations) and Nuclear Energy and Engineering (4 citations). Purnachandra Saha has collaborated with scholars based in India, Canada and Taiwan. Frequent co-authors include Swagato Das, Sanjaya Kumar Patro, R. S. Jangid, Bibhuti Bhusan Das, Salim Barbhuiya, Rishi Gupta, Suresh Chandra Satapathy, S. Anusha, Ashok Kumar Pandey and Prasanna Kumar Acharya. Their work appears in journals such as SHILAP Revista de lepidopterología, Measurement and Materials Today Proceedings.
